I've always loved "My All" but something about it in my most recent listen to Butterfly has really elevated it to an all-time Mariah top ten material for me. Not enough is really made of Mariah as a vocalist who can really deliver a melody beyond just the technical vocal standpoint. The Latin flourishes, which were actually a good couple years ahead of the whole Latin-pop, Ricky Martin explosion that influenced her peers later on, really work a treat with her tender, delicate interpretation of it. That last "I'd risk my liiiiifeee, to feeeeel..." really gets at the core too. And then "The Roof" comes on...
